Role Mission:

We are looking for a hands-on Deal Desk & Salesforce Analyst to support our Sales and Revenue Operations teams. This role is responsible for ensuring deals move quickly and accurately through the pipeline while also maintaining and improving Salesforce as the system of record. You will work directly with Sales, Finance, and Legal to support pricing, approvals, and contracts, while helping commercial reps configure their opportunities , reports, and data management tasks.

Key Responsibilities

Deal Desk

  • Deal Structuring & Pricing Support:

  • Partner with sales to design and optimise deal structures (discount levels, payment terms, bundling, multi-year agreements)

  • Assist the sales team in processing quotes, pricing requests, and contract terms to ensure compliance with internal policies.

  • Quote-to-Cash Process Management:

  • Together with our Sales Operations Analyst:

  • Own the end-to-end quote approval workflow (discount approvals, non-standard terms, exception handling).

  • Ensure all quotes are accurately built in SFDC CPQ

  • Track and enforce compliance with internal policies and approval matrices.

  • Cross-Functional Coordination:

  • Act as the bridge between sales, finance, legal, and operations to get deals over the finish line

  • Coordinate contract reviews, legal red-lines, and escalations both through CLM system, or offline.

  • Keep all stakeholders aligned on risks, timelines, and approvals

  • Policy Enforcement & Governance:

  • Apply discounting, pricing, and contracting policies consistently

  • Flag out-of-policy requests, escalate as needed, and document exceptions

  • Maintain playbooks for standard and non-standard deal terms

  • Act as a partner to Sales to ensure regular pipeline reviews, data maintenance and periodic enhancements.

  • Reporting, Analytics & Continuous Improvement:

  • Track KPIs such as average deal cycle time, win rates, discount trends, among others

  • Provide insights to leadership

  • Continuously refine processes, tools, and approval flows to increase efficiency and deal velocity

Salesforce Administration & Analysis

  • Work closely with our Salesforce Developers, by serving as one of the day-to-day administrators and flagging gaps and proposing enhancements

  • Run regular data quality checks (duplication, missing data, field updates).

  • Build and deliver ad-hoc reports and dashboards for Sales and Revenue teams.

  • Assist with enhancements, testing, and rollouts of new Salesforce features or integrations.

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ent practical experience.

  • 2–4 years of experience in Deal Desk, Sales Operations, or Salesforce Administration.

  • Salesforce Administrator certification (ADM201) preferred.

  • Experience with Salesforce CPQ (or similar quoting tools)

  • Detail-oriented with strong organisational and multitasking skills.

  • Comfortable working directly with Sales teams in a fast-paced environment across mid-market and enterprise teams

  • Experience in a multi-product SaaS business is an advantage

What We Do

CUBE is an established leader in Automated Regulatory Intelligence (ARI) and Regulatory Change Management (RCM). We deliver next-generation solutions that keep customers ahead of every-changing regulatory demands, enable them to reduce the risk of regulatory breaches or the propensity to miss regulations. The CUBE RegPlatform product portfolio is powered by a purpose-built regulatory AI engine (RegBrain). They track, analyse, and monitor laws, rules, and regulations in every country and in every published language to create an always up-to-date regulatory view.

With over 700 employees, a global footprint across six main hubs, we can support customer needs across all time zones and territories. CUBE has c.1000 customers in banking, insurance, asset and investment management, payments and associated industries.
